Core Viewpoint - Yingluo Technology is a significant player in the domestic rare earth permanent magnet materials and motor products industry, showcasing strong R&D capabilities and industry chain integration advantages [1] Group 1: Business Performance - In Q3 2025, Yingluo achieved a revenue of 2.727 billion yuan, ranking 5th in the industry, surpassing the industry average of 2.149 billion yuan and the median of 1.243 billion yuan [2] - The main business composition includes NdFeB at 882 million yuan (50.86%), motor series at 435 million yuan (25.10%), electric wheelchairs and mobility scooters at 223 million yuan (12.88%), and audio speaker products at 133 million yuan (7.69%) [2] - The net profit for the same period was 205 million yuan, also ranking 5th in the industry, above the industry average of 171 million yuan and the median of 127 million yuan [2] Group 2: Financial Ratios - As of Q3 2025, Yingluo's debt-to-asset ratio was 36.51%, higher than the previous year's 30.75% and above the industry average of 33.39% [3] - The gross profit margin for Q3 2025 was 19.72%, slightly down from 19.78% in the previous year and below the industry average of 24.35% [3] Group 3: Shareholder Information - As of September 30, 2025, the number of A-share shareholders decreased by 18.53% to 112,300, while the average number of circulating A-shares held per household increased by 22.75% to 10,100 [5] - Notable shareholders include Hong Kong Central Clearing Limited and various ETFs, with significant changes in their holdings compared to the previous period [5] Group 4: Executive Compensation - The chairman and general manager, Wei Zhonghua, received a salary of 1.12 million yuan in 2024, an increase of 420,000 yuan from 2023 [4] Group 5: Market Outlook - The company reported a revenue decline of 9.87% year-on-year for the first three quarters of 2025, with a net profit decrease of 3.16% [6] - The core businesses of NdFeB magnets and motor products account for over 75% of revenue, with expectations for growth supported by demand in the electric vehicle and variable frequency air conditioning sectors [6]
